See the License for the specific language governing permissions and limitations under the License. */ package com.ibm.hybrid.cloud.sample.stocktrader.trader.health; //Standard I/O classes import java.io.PrintWriter; import java.io.StringWriter; //Logging (JSR 47) import java.util.logging.Level; import java.util.logging.Logger; //CDI 2.0 import javax.enterprise.context.ApplicationScoped; //mpHealth 1.0 import org.eclipse.microprofile.health.HealthCheck; import org.eclipse.microprofile.health.HealthCheckResponse; import org.eclipse.microprofile.health.HealthCheckResponseBuilder; import org.eclipse.microprofile.health.Readiness; @Readiness @ApplicationScoped /** Use mpHealth for readiness probe */ public class ReadinessProbe implements HealthCheck { private static Logger logger = Logger.getLogger(ReadinessProbe.class.getName()); private static String jwtAudience = System.getenv("JWT_AUDIENCE"); private static String jwtIssuer = System.getenv("JWT_ISSUER"); //mpHealth probe public HealthCheckResponse call() { HealthCheckResponse response = null; String message = "Ready"; try { HealthCheckResponseBuilder builder = HealthCheckResponse.named("Trader"); if ((jwtAudience==null) || (jwtIssuer==null)) { //can't run without these env vars builder = builder.down(); message = "JWT environment variables not set!"; logger.warning("Returning NOT ready!"); } else { builder = builder.up(); logger.fine("Returning ready!"); } builder = builder.withData("message", message); response = builder.build(); } catch (Throwable t) { logger.warning("Exception occurred during health check: "+t.getMessage()); logException(t); throw t; } return response; } private static void logException(Throwable t) { logger.warning(t.getClass().getName()+": "+t.getMessage()); //only log the stack trace if the level has been set to at least INFO if (logger.isLoggable(Level.INFO)) { StringWriter writer = new StringWriter(); t.printStackTrace(new PrintWriter(writer)); logger.info(writer.toString()); } } }
